Transaction 34f3cce67659e0981bbd74bcd85b5673e87ce35e2f6af9fcbc48df2797ec714b

2 Input
2 Outputs
  • 34f3cce67659e0981bbd74bcd85b5673e87ce35e2f6af9fcbc48df2797ec714b:0
  • value  31765000
    address  15hjkXXcABtuKxEKknDk38194M68QzuifB
  • 34f3cce67659e0981bbd74bcd85b5673e87ce35e2f6af9fcbc48df2797ec714b:1
  • value  26650
    address  3P9qAZvi7bVPw35P3PVMqV1ePGQDB17HEt